如何在终端中运行shadowsocks代理

什么是shadowsocks代理

shadowsocks是一种基于Socks5代理方式的加密传输协议,可以帮助用户绕过网络审查和访问被封锁的网站。

在终端中运行shadowsocks代理的步骤

步骤一:安装shadowsocks客户端

  1. 使用终端命令安装shadowsocks客户端

    $ pip install shadowsocks

  2. 配置shadowsocks客户端

    $ vi /etc/shadowsocks/config.json

    在打开的配置文件中输入服务器地址、端口号、加密方式、密码等信息。

步骤二:运行shadowsocks代理

  1. 启动shadowsocks代理

    $ sslocal -c /etc/shadowsocks/config.json

  2. 验证代理是否运行成功 使用浏览器或其他应用程序尝试访问被封锁的网站,如果可以正常访问则代表代理运行成功。

常见问题解答

如何在终端中停止shadowsocks代理?

  • 使用Ctrl + C组合键停止正在运行的shadowsocks代理。

为什么无法连接到shadowsocks服务器?

  • 可能是服务器地址、端口号、密码等配置信息输入有误,检查配置文件中的信息是否正确。
  • 可能是服务器端口未开放或被防火墙阻挡,联系服务器管理员解决。

如何在终端中修改shadowsocks配置?

  • 使用vi或其他文本编辑器打开配置文件/etc/shadowsocks/config.json,对需要修改的信息进行编辑并保存。

以上是在终端中运行shadowsocks代理的详细步骤和常见问题解答,希望可以帮助您顺利运行shadowsocks代理。

正文完